Apple has announced a significant expansion of its Business Connect service, allowing businesses to increase their visibility across Apple's vast ecosystem of devices and platforms. The free service, launched last year, enables businesses to manage their presence across Apple's 1.5 billion devices in areas such as Maps, Siri, Spotlight search, Safari, and Wallet. With the latest update, businesses will be able to integrate their branding into other Apple products, including Mail, Tap to Pay on iPhone, and the Apple Phone app, further enhancing their online presence and customer engagement.

The updated Business Connect service will now offer a range of new features, including:

  • Branded Mail: Businesses will be able to customize their email display in Apple's Mail app, featuring their brand's name and logo in the inbox and a colorful header at the top of the screen. This will enable businesses to establish a strong visual identity and make their emails stand out in a crowded inbox.
  • Tap-to-Pay: The business's icon will replace the generic category icon, and the business's name will be customizable during the payment process. This will enable businesses to create a seamless and personalized payment experience for their customers.
  • Phone App: The integration will identify calls by featuring the business name, logo, and department, helping consumers determine which calls may be unwanted or spam. This will enable businesses to establish a strong reputation and build trust with their customers.

In addition to these new features, the expanded Business Connect service will also allow businesses to:

  • Customize their brand's presence across more Apple apps and features
  • Manage their brand's presence at scale through listing management agencies
  • Access insights on how consumers are interacting with their business

The expanded features will be available to "most" businesses worldwide by signing up for Business Connect with an Apple account. Businesses can also manage their location presence at scale through listing management agencies like DAC Group, Rio SEO, SOCi, Uberall, and Yext.

"We're excited to offer all businesses — including those without a physical location — the ability to create a brand that appears across the Apple apps that over a billion people use every day," said David Dorn, Apple's senior director of Internet Software and Services Product. "We designed Business Connect to empower businesses to present the best, most accurate information to Apple users. With today's updates, we're helping even more businesses reach customers, build trust, and grow."
